Sovereignty Without Omniscience
Sovereignty over a complex AI-mediated system does not require exhaustive local comprehension of every mechanism. It requires the system to be built so that legibility, reviewable trails, bounded authority, and role-appropriate visibility are in place at the layers that actually matter for retained human authority.
The problem most operators reach for the wrong way
As AI-mediated systems get more capable, more layered, and more integrated, the operator's question quietly shifts from can I make this work to can I still own what it does on my behalf. The instinct is to reach for understanding — I have to know how every mechanism works, or I cannot be responsible for it. That instinct is honest, and it is also, increasingly, a trap.
Most operators will not, and should not, fully comprehend every local mechanism in advanced AI systems. That ship is mostly past the harbor. The question that has replaced the omniscience question is more useful: what does the system have to make true so that I remain meaningfully in control of what it does in my name?
The false binary: omniscience or surrender
The dominant default is a binary. Either you understand every detail (sovereignty by comprehension), or you trust the system (sovereignty surrendered). Most real choices fall outside that binary, and treating it as the only frame is part of why "AI governance" conversations stall.
The structural alternative is sovereignty preserved by what the system makes visible, bounded, and reviewable — not by what the operator can recall in working memory.
What sovereignty without omniscience requires
To be useful, the phrase has to mean something specific. Sovereignty without omniscience requires four operational properties at the layers that matter for the operator's actual authority:
- Legibility before action. You do not need to remember how the system works. You need to be able to see what it is about to do, on what basis, before it does it. Legibility is a property of the system's surfaces, not a property of the operator's memory.
- Bounded authority enforced by architecture. The scope the system is authorized to act inside is explicit and held by the system, not by a written rule the operator has to monitor continuously. The boundary holds at the edges without the operator standing at the gate.
- Reviewable trails on demand. After the fact, the operator can reconstruct what was done, why, and under what authority — without forensic effort, in a single sitting, from the system's own surfaces.
- Role-appropriate visibility. The operator sees what the operator needs to act sovereignly. Not the whole mechanism stack. Not nothing. The view is matched to the operator's actual decisions, not to a generic dashboard.
Each property is structural. Each is testable. None of them require the operator to be a domain expert in every subsystem the AI integrates with.
What this is not
Sovereignty without omniscience is not "trust the system." Trust without legibility is surrender wearing a different jacket. The phrase only carries weight when the legibility, review, boundary, and visibility architecture is verifiably in place. Operators should be able to ask, of any system claiming to support sovereignty without omniscience, show me the surfaces that satisfy the four properties above.
It is also not a claim that comprehension is unnecessary. Comprehension is still useful where the operator needs it. The point is that comprehension is no longer the load-bearing thing. The architecture is.

FAQ
- Does sovereignty without omniscience mean I can use AI without understanding it?
- No. It means you can remain sovereign over a system you cannot fully comprehend in detail — if the system is built to preserve legibility before action, bounded authority, reviewable trails, and role-appropriate visibility. The architecture does the work that exhaustive comprehension would otherwise have to.
- Is this the same as "trust the AI"?
- No. Trust without legibility is surrender. Sovereignty without omniscience requires the legibility, review, boundary, and visibility architecture to be in place and verifiable.
